Cinematic Achievements and Direction by Denis Villeneuve
Visual Storytelling and Production Design
Denis Villeneuve anchored the film’s success in meticulous world-building, from the minimalist architecture of Arrakis to the grandeur of ornithopter flight sequences. The production design emphasized texture and scale, making each planet feel tactile and lived-in.
Score, Sound Design, and Audience Immersion
Hans Zimmer’s low, droning score amplified the film’s contemplative tension, while the immersive sound mix placed viewers inside the desert storms and political councils. Audio choices reinforced the emotional core of Paul Atreides’ journey.
